Russia and South Korea are committed to the denuclearization of the Korean Peninsula,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ov said on Monday.
Moscow and Seoul will not accept Pyongyang's self-proclaimed nuclear status, he said after talks with his South Korean counterpart Yun Byung-se.

South Korea's defense ministry said Monday it has responded to North Korea's latest offer for military talks by calling on the North to make its stance on denuclearization clear, Yonhap news agency reported.
The government also said denuclearization steps should be a top priority in any inter-Korean dialogue.
